Newborn Throwing Up Chunky Formula. What makes the milk curdle? There are several reasons why your baby might be vomiting after a formula feeding, but it’s important to remember that it can be — and often is — very normal. The curdling of milk in your baby’s stomach occurs when the stomach acid mixes with the breast milk or formula milk but does not digest it fully (2).
